The Mystery (Le mystere), 1900

EDITORS COMMENTS
by Paul Albert Besnard is a captivating and thought-provoking artwork that delves into the realms of allegory and astronomy. This black and white etching and aquatint print, created in the early 20th century, transports viewers to a mysterious world where concepts such as life, death, and the solar system intertwine. At first glance, one's eyes are drawn to an eerie figure standing under the full moon. Cloaked in darkness, this allegorical figure represents none other than Death himself - the Grim Reaper. Clutching his scythe with skeletal hands, he stands as a haunting reminder of mortality. Besnard's attention to detail is evident in every stroke of this print. The lunar landscape surrounding Death adds an element of mystery while symbolizing our connection to the celestial bodies above. Through this juxtaposition of life and death against the backdrop of the solar system, Besnard invites us to contemplate our place within the vastness of existence.
